Say Goodbye to Ringless Voicemail: Your Ultimate Blocking Solution
Are you tired of those pesky ringless voicemail spam calls piling up on your phone? These automated voice messages, also known as robotexts, can be a real nuisance, leaving unwanted recordings on your voicemail. But don't worry, there are ways to combat these intrusive calls and reclaim your peace of mind.
- First and foremost, you can disable the ability for unknown callers to leave recordings on your phone. Check your phone's settings menu to find this option.
- Explore the use of|Try a dedicated call blocking app. These apps analyze incoming calls and can effectively block spam callers.
- Another effective solution is to register your phone number with the National Do Not Call Registry. While this won't block all ringless voicemails, it will help reduce the amount of telemarketing calls you receive.
By utilizing these strategies, you can significantly reduce the number of unwanted ringless voicemails and enjoy a more peaceful phone experience.
The Silent Invasion: Understanding Ringless Voicemail
Ringless voicemail, a surprising new method of communication, is rapidly gaining in popularity. This technology allows companies to deliver voice messages directly to a recipient's voicemail without ringing their phone.
Consequently, recipients are often unaware that they have received a message until they review their voicemail inbox. This absence of notification can result in missed calls and important information being missed.
Furthermore, ringless voicemail can be exploited for unwanted purposes. Scammers may use this method to impersonate to be legitimate companies in an attempt to scam unsuspecting victims.
